TAV College is a private college located in Montreal, Quebec. Founded in 1991, the institution offers vocational and pre-university programs (DEC & AEC) in both English and French. It is located in the Côte-des-Neiges borough of Montreal. TAV College boasts a brand new 65,000 Square foot, building, annexing its original campus on Decarie Boulevard. This state-of- the-art building houses four science laboratories and facilities for career and pre-university programs. TAV College hosts 1000 students who come from a multitude of cultural communities and credits its success to its ability to improve access to quality higher education programs to a multi-ethnic immigrant population.

History

Born 25 years ago from a strong desire to provide the community with education and training, TAV College began as an affiliate of Champlain College but is now a private CEGEP recognized and accredited for subsidies from the Quebec Ministry of Education. TAV was founded by Abraham Boyarsky, a professor in Concordia’s Department of Mathematics and Statistics.

Programs

TAV College offers two types of programs: pre-university and career/technical. Pre-university programs take two to three years to complete and cover subject matter that roughly corresponds to the additional year of high school given elsewhere in Canada, as well as university-level introductory courses that prepare students for their chosen field in university. Technical programs vary in length from one to three years and allow graduates to enter the workforce.
